23 //------------------------------------------------------------------------------
24 /// @brief Packs rectangles into a specified area without rotating them.
25 ///
27  public:
28  //----------------------------------------------------------------------------
29  /// @brief Return an empty packer with area specified by width and height.
30  ///
31  static std::shared_ptr<RectanglePacker> Factory(int width, int height);
32 
33  virtual ~RectanglePacker() {}
34 
35  //----------------------------------------------------------------------------
36  /// @brief Attempt to add a rect without moving already placed rectangles.
37  ///
38  /// @param[in] width The width of the rectangle to add.
39  /// @param[in] height The height of the rectangle to add.
40  /// @param[out] loc If successful, will be set to the position of the
41  /// upper-left corner of the rectangle.
42  ///
43  /// @return Return true on success; false on failure.
44  ///
45  virtual bool AddRect(int width, int height, IPoint16* loc) = 0;
46 
47  //----------------------------------------------------------------------------
48  /// @brief Returns how much area has been filled with rectangles.
49  ///
50  /// @return Percentage as a decimal between 0.0 and 1.0
51  ///
52  virtual Scalar PercentFull() const = 0;
53 
54  //----------------------------------------------------------------------------
55  /// @brief Empty out all previously added rectangles.
56  ///
57  virtual void Reset() = 0;
58 
59  protected:
60  RectanglePacker(int width, int height) : width_(width), height_(height) {
61  FML_DCHECK(width >= 0);
62  FML_DCHECK(height >= 0);
63  }
64 
65  int width() const { return width_; }
66  int height() const { return height_; }
67 
68  private:
69  const int width_;
70  const int height_;
71 };
